Rianne Levink is a scholar working on Oncology, Cancer Research and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Rianne Levink has authored 3 papers receiving a total of 163 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 3 papers in Oncology, 2 papers in Cancer Research and 1 paper in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Rianne Levink’s work include Cancer Cells and Metastasis (2 papers),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(2 papers) and Pharmacogenetics and Drug Metabolism (1 paper). Rianne Levink is often cited by papers focused on Cancer Cells and Metastasis (2 papers),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(2 papers) and Pharmacogenetics and Drug Metabolism (1 paper). Rianne Levink collaborates with scholars based in The Netherlands. Rianne Levink's co-authors include Arjan G.J. Tibbe, Ronald Sipkema, Joost F. Swennenhuis, Leon W.M.M. Terstappen, Maarten J. Deenen, Jan H.M. Schellens, Dianne E. van der Wal, Jos H. Beijnen, Monique J. Bijl and Irma Meijerman and has published in prestigious journals such as Cancer Research, Toxicology and Applied Pharmacology and Cytometry Part A.
